Transaction 71eac938cd34e6971072ca3027df66bd7ca43903413cdff44da2141dfd3612a6

1 Input
2 Outputs
  • 71eac938cd34e6971072ca3027df66bd7ca43903413cdff44da2141dfd3612a6:0
  • value  66000000
    address  328hiAAqkEiuuwxo7vqRJw9Q6RqjcVxzJd
  • 71eac938cd34e6971072ca3027df66bd7ca43903413cdff44da2141dfd3612a6:1
  • value  506060000
    address  1MooRbjkDguVj9NEMDpJEeswkgKaWsQLVB